Eligibility Criteria

18 Years - 65 Years (Adult, Older Adult)All SexesDoes not accept healthy volunteers

Inclusion Criteria:

  • Body mass index (BMI) 30 to 50.
  • Subject Type 2 Diabetes Criteria:

    1. T2DM diagnosis ≥6 months but < 10 years
    2. On 1 or more oral diabetes medications (with one at the minimum recommended therapeutic dose)
    3. Hemoglobin A1C (HbA1c) between and including 6.5 and 10.0% (58 mmol/mol to 86 mmol/mol) at time of enrollment and has had a stable HbA1c over a 3-month period (i.e., <0.3% reduction)
    4. Stable medication regimen (i.e., no change in diabetes medications) for at least 3 months prior to Screening Visit.
  • If subject has obesity-related comorbidities such as hypertension, dyslipidemia, and sleep apnea, these comorbidities must be well-controlled.
  • Able to understand and sign informed consent document
  • Has primary care physician and/or endocrinologist who follows patient for all comorbid conditions

Exclusion Criteria:

  • Known or suspected allergy to nickel or titanium or Nitinol
  • Type 1 Diabetes
  • Use of injectable insulin
  • Uncontrolled T2DM Fasting glucose ≥ 200 mg/dl (11.1 mmol/L)
  • Probable insulin production failure, defined as fasting serum C Peptide <1 ng/mL (0.3 nmol/l)
  • Any documented conditions for which endoscopy/colonoscopy would be contraindicated.
  • Contraindication to general anesthesia
  • Congenital or acquired anomalies of the GI tract, including atresias, stenosis or malrotation.
  • Any previous major surgery on the stomach (excluding sleeve gastrectomy), duodenum, hepatobiliary tree (excluding gallbladder), pancreas or right colon.
  • Previous technically difficult or failed colonoscopy or endoscopy
  • If on metformin, history of polycystic ovarian syndrome (PCOS)
  • Unable or unwilling to perform home blood glucose monitoring
  • History of or suspected gastrointestinal disease (e.g. cirrhosis, inflammatory bowel disease)
  • Diagnosis of active malignancy (i.e. not in remission) with the exception of squamous or basal cell carcinoma of the skin
  • Previous surgical or endoscopic treatment for obesity including but not restricted to intragastric balloons, endoscopic suturing or stapling procedures, malabsorptive sleeves.
  • Specific genetic or hormonal cause of obesity (e.g. Prader-Willi syndrome)

5. Study Description

Brief Summary
Study will monitor changes in HbA1c for subjects in Intervention arm vs control arm.
Detailed Description
Randomized, Single-Center, Parallel-group, Open-label Pilot Study to Evaluate the Safety and Effectiveness of the GI Windows Magnet Anastomosis System (MAS) When Used to Create a Dual-path Enteral Diversion Compared with Medical Therapy Alone To Effect Glycemic Control in Obese Patients with Type 2 Diabetes Mellitus (T2DM)

Intervention Type
Device
Intervention Name(s)
Magnet Anastomosis System
Other Intervention Name(s)
MAS
Intervention Description
The MAS will be placed using an endoscope in the duodenum and and laparoscopically into ileum. A compression anastomosis will be created in each of the patients and the diversion of enteral flow from the duodenum to ileum treats Type 2 diabetes.
